Job summary

Protingent is seeking a Senior/Principal Finite Element Analyst specializing in thermomechanical and structural mechanics for a direct-hire role in Austin, TX. You will develop robust FE models for reactor components under coupled thermal-mechanical loads and deliver analyses that inform safety margins and design decisions.

You will lead linear/nonlinear, thermal, fatigue, buckling, and seismic analyses using NASTRAN and other solvers, collaborating with thermal-hydraulics and reactor systems

Qualifications

  • Bachelor’s degree in Mechanical Engineering, Nuclear Engineering, Civil/Structural Engineering, Aerospace Engineering, or a closely related discipline.
  • 10+ years of professional finite element analysis experience in nuclear, aerospace, energy, pressure systems, defense, or another high-consequence engineering environment.
  • Deep understanding of structural mechanics, thermomechanics, heat transfer, stress analysis, and finite element methods.
  • Strong experience with NASTRAN for structural, thermal, modal, dynamic, or coupled analysis.
  • Experience evaluating pressure-retaining components, reactor internals, piping, support structures, heat exchangers, high-temperature equipment, or similar safety-critical hardware.
  • Working knowledge of ASME Boiler and Pressure Vessel Code Section III.
  • Demonstrated ability to define load cases, boundary conditions, contacts/interfaces, mesh strategies, convergence checks, and model verification approaches.
  • Strong engineering judgment and ability to determine whether analysis results are physically reasonable.
  • Proven ability to write clear technical documentation and defend assumptions, methods, results, and conclusions in rigorous design reviews.

Responsibilities

  • Develop, execute, and maintain finite element models for reactor components, structures, and mechanical systems subject to coupled thermal and mechanical loading.
  • Perform linear and nonlinear structural analysis, thermal stress analysis, fatigue evaluation, buckling assessment, modal/dynamic analysis, and seismic response analysis.
  • Evaluate high-temperature components and structures against applicable nuclear design codes and standards, including ASME Boiler and Pressure Vessel Code Section III.
  • Use NASTRAN and other commercial solvers to analyze complex load cases, boundary conditions, interfaces, and transient operating conditions.
  • Support sodium-cooled reactor design by evaluating thermal gradients, pressure loads, mechanical loads, restraint loads, seismic loads, radiation effects, startup/shutdown transients, and off-normal events.
  • Collaborate with thermal-hydraulics and reactor systems teams on fluid-structure interaction problems, flow-induced vibration, thermal striping, and coupled structural response.
  • Translate analysis results into clear design recommendations, safety margins, test requirements, and engineering tradeoffs.
  • Prepare high-quality technical reports, calculation packages, and analysis documentation for internal design reviews, licensing support, and quality-controlled engineering work.
  • Establish modeling standards, verification practices, analysis templates, and review expectations for structural and thermomechanical analysis at company.
  • Mentor engineers and analysts; serve as a technical authority for finite element methods, structural mechanics, and thermomechanical design evaluation.
